07:00 AEST After an emotional mid-year cut at the Margaret River Pro surf competition in Western Australia last week, surfers that fell below the cut line, along with up-and-coming talent, will be battling it out on the Gold Coast from this weekend onwards.  The first stop on the Challenger Series (the lesser format of the Championship Tour) will take place along the Gold Coast’s premier surf point breaks, starting this morning and running to Saturday May 4th.
